My Birth Story Part 3: I felt so connected and in tune with my body and with my baby. It was like this dance that we were doing together… His spiraling downward movement combined with my gentle stretching and opening. I can honestly say that it never felt like something that I wasn’t going to be capable of doing. It never felt too painful or too intense. I believe in the power of natural childbirth and in our body’s wisdom. I also could feel my child’s intelligence within me and knew that his body was doing what it needed to be doing and that he would be born in the perfect time and in the perfect way to support his life’s mission and soul’s purpose. Never once did I consider transferring to the hospital. The home environment felt so peaceful and sacred. We had created a beautiful birthing nest and I had my Guy, our doula and 2 others present who were providing us all with support. It felt like exactly how it should be and that we were all in it together and helping each other. Things picked up again after 2pm and I got back into the birthing pool. I could feel my son’s head dropping through my birth canal and at some point I was able to reach down and feel the top of his head so I knew we were close. And when my baby’s head was starting to crown, I actually heard the words of Johnny Cash song in my head as he described the “Burning Ring of Fire”. It’s true. It Burns, Burns, Burns… The Rings of Fire. (to be continued)
